I failed an Ohio e-check due to my check engine light being on. I took the car to a Subaru dealer and paid $277 for a new knock sensor. Make a long story short, I've taken the carback to the e-check every Saturday for 2 months and have yet to actually take another test. They scan it and it reads 'not ready'. I've put over 2,00 miles on it and the folks at Subaru are at a losss. the kicker is, if I had spent $300, they would allow me to take the test.

How do I get a 2207 Subaru Legacy Limited Edition Outback to runn through the drive cycle and be ready to test? My plates expired in September!

You may want to take it back to the dealer. They should not have erased the codes after the repair for your knock sensor. They should have driven it through the drive cycle; so that the computer would retain all the set monitors.it had at that time.
